Shane wins a Golden Guitar plus collaborates with Paul Kelly
Shane NIhcolson won the highly coveted APRA SONG OF THE YEAR for the title track from his critically acclaimed album BAD MACHINES at the Jayco C.M.A.A Country Music Awards announced on Saturday night at Tamworth.
With a total of six nominations the album obviously found favour with the country music voting panel, and his nomination for VOCAL COLLABORATION OF THE YEAR, which features iconic Australian Paul Kelly on guest vocals, is very timely given it's release this week.
"Whistling Cannonballs was one of those rare songs that almost seem to write themselves" says Shane. "It just fell out of me. I had Paul Kelly's voice in my head as I was writing, imagining him singing it, relaying the story. So to have him record it with me was a dream come true."
The accompanying video clip was shot by Duncan Toombs at the beautiful Eauropean styled Artsits Colony in Monstsalvat in Melbourne's North East. Shane & Paul found themselves very at home on the chaise lounge in the 'Great Hall'surrounded by sculptures, artworks buy the current residents and founding artists.
Also worth noting that Shane produced Beccy Cole's award winning album 'Songs & Pictures' and he was also nominated as 'Producer of the Year' for that recording.
Shane sold out his only show at the 'Tamworth Inn'and will soon head out to perform at several festivals.
